When Warren Buffet, the world’s third richest man celebrated his 80th birthday, he was asked to give just one piece of advice to those aspiring to achieve wealth and happiness. His reply was,

‘The one piece of advice I can give you is, do what turns you on. Do something that if you had all the money in the world, you’d still be doing it. You’ve got to have a reason to jump out of bed in the morning.’
